Regulation of Vascular Endothelial Growth Factor Expression by EMMPRIN via the PI3K-Akt Signaling Pathway

Abstract: Extracellular matrix metalloproteinase (MMP) inducer (EMMPRIN) is a cell surface glycoprotein overexpressed in many solid tumors. In addition to its ability to stimulate stromal MMP expression, tumor-associated EMMPRIN also induces v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) expression. To explore the underlying signaling pathways used by EMMPRIN, we studied the involvement of phosphoinositide 3-kinase (PI3K)-Akt, m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K), JUN, and p38 kinases in EMMPRIN-mediated VEGF regulation. … Show more

“…Recently, several studies have convincingly demonstrated that CD147 not only plays an important role in tumor progression by inducing MMP production but also stimulates tumor angiogenesis by regulating v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) expression (2). Overexpression of CD147 in MDA-MB-231 breast cancer cells regulates VEGF production via the PI3K-Akt signaling pathway (3). Downregulation of CD147 expression by the antisense RNA decreases the secretions of MMP-2, MMP-9, VEGF, and the invasive ability of human glioblastoma cells (4).…”
